2년 전 HTML5 표준의 출시는 웹 개발 커뮤니티에 큰 사건이었습니다. 인상적인 일련의 새로운 기능이 포함되어 있을 뿐만 아니라 1999년 HTML 4.01 표준이 출시된 이후 HTML에 대한 최초의 주요 버전 업데이트이기 때문입니다. "현대적인" HTML5 표준을 사용한다고 자랑하는 일부 웹사이트를 여전히 볼 수 있습니다.
다행히도 우리는 HTML 표준에 대한 다음 업데이트를 그렇게 오래 기다릴 필요가 없습니다. 2015년 10월, W3C는 HTML5의 남은 문제 중 일부를 해결한다는 목표로 HTML5.1 초안 작업을 시작했습니다. 여러 번의 반복 끝에 초안은 2016년 6월 "후보 권장 사항" 단계, 2016년 9월 "제안 권장 사항" 단계에 도달했으며, 마침내 2016년 11월 W3C 권장 사항이 출시되었습니다. 새로운 표준에 주의를 기울이는 사람들은 그것이 구불구불한 길이었음을 알아차렸을 것입니다. 처음에 제안된 많은 HTML5.1 기능은 잘못된 디자인이나 브라우저 공급업체 지원 부족으로 인해 폐기되었습니다.
HTML5.1은 아직 개발 중이지만 W3C는 HTML5.2 초안 작업을 시작했으며 2017년 후반에 출시될 예정입니다. 이 문서는 HTML5.1의 몇 가지 흥미로운 새로운 기능과 개선 사항에 대한 개요입니다. 이러한 기능에 대한 브라우저 지원은 아직 부족하지만 최소한 각 예를 테스트할 수 있도록 이러한 기능을 지원하는 몇 가지 브라우저를 보여 드리겠습니다.
상황에 맞는 메뉴는 메뉴 및 메뉴 항목 요소를 사용합니다
HTML5.1 초안에는 컨텍스트와 도구 모음이라는 두 가지 메뉴 요소가 도입되었습니다. 전자는 일반적으로 페이지에서 마우스 오른쪽 버튼을 클릭하여 활성화되는 로컬 상황에 맞는 메뉴를 확장하는 데 사용되며, 후자는 공통 메뉴 구성 요소를 정의하는 데 사용됩니다. 개발 과정에서 툴바는 사라졌지만 컨텍스트 메뉴는 살아남았습니다.
성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.